NEW ULM — Elinor Daugherty, age 91 of New Ulm passed away Thursday, Nov. 19, 2020 at the New Richland Care Center.

Funeral service will be 11 a.m. Tuesday, Nov. 24, at the Minnesota Valley Funeral Home – NORTH Chapel with Pastor Bradly Kuebler officiating. Burial will follow at the Riverside Cemetery in Madelia. Visitation will be one hour prior to the service at the funeral home.

She is survived by her son, Daniel (Diane) Daugherty; four grandchildren; several great-grandchildren; her brother, Vernon Sundstrom and her nieces and nephews.

She is preceded in death by her parents; husband, Eldridge; son, Timothy and her brother, Sidney (LaVera) Sundstrom.

Elinor Lucille Sundstrom was born Jan. 30, 1929 in Centerville, South Dakota to Simon and Anna (Johnson) Sundstrom. She moved to Lake Crystal in 1941 and later on to Madelia. She married Eldridge Daugherty on Oct. 16, 1950 at the Church of Christ in Madelia. The couple moved to New Ulm in 1957. Elinor enjoyed her flower garden and gardening, sewing, camping and fishing.
